
Who loves the movie “The Wedding Singer”? This inspired cross-stitch pattern would be great to stitch for a wedding or to show your favorite person you want to grow old with them.
The design by Good Morning Maui is 69 by 59 stitches (about 5 by 4 inches on 14-count fabric) and uses 9 colors of thread.
I love it on the gray fabric shown but it would also be cute on light blue or off-white. Or dye some fabric for a wedding-appropriate color.

One of the easiest ways to make a cross stitch project more personal is to add text to it. Whether you’re adding the names of people getting married to a generic floral cross stitch design, birth information to a project on theme with the new baby’s room or just adding a word or phrase that’s meaningful to you, adding words to cross stitch projects make them that much more special.
